Automatiser la génération de rapports Excel avec Python

Automatiser la génération de rapports Excel avec Python

Aujourd’hui, je partage un petit projet d’automatisation utile pour les professionnels de la data, du marketing, ou de la gestion :

Générer automatiquement un rapport Excel avec Python.Générer automatiquement un rapport Excel avec Python.

Objectif

Au lieu de créer vos fichiers Excel manuellement chaque semaine, ce script va générer un rapport complet (avec formules, graphiques ou statistiques) en un seul clic.

Technologies utilisées

  • Pandas : pour gérer les données
  • OpenPyXL : pour créer et formater les fichiers Excel
  • datetime : pour dater les rapports automatiquement

Résultat

Ce script crée un fichier nommé par exemple :
👉 rapport_ventes_2025-10-30.xlsx
contenant les ventes, les objectifs, et le taux de réussite de chaque employé.

Améliorations possibles :

  • Ajouter un graphique automatique dans le rapport.
  • Envoyer le rapport par e-mail chaque matin.
  • Se connecter à une base de données réelle (ex. MySQL, PostgreSQL).

Avec quelques lignes de Python, on peut transformer une tâche répétitive en un processus 100 % automatisé.
C’est un excellent exercice pour apprendre à manipuler Pandas et Excel dans un contexte professionnel.

Comments

No comments yet. Why don’t you start the discussion?

Laisser un commentaire

Votre adresse e-mail ne sera pas publiée. Les champs obligatoires sont indiqués avec *